Finding Your Keywords: The Heart of SEO
No SEO strategy is complete without a robust keyword research phase. This is where the magic begins. Keywords are the phrases people type into search engines, and identifying the right ones can propel your website to the top.
Primary Keywords vs. Long-Tail Keywords
Think of primary keywords as the main dish at a fancy restaurant, while long-tail keywords are like the delicious side dishes that complement the meal. Primary keywords are often more general and competitive, while long-tail keywords are specific phrases that cater to niche audiences. For instance, “website design†is a primary keyword while “affordable website design for small businesses†is a long-tail keyword. Using a mix of both can enhance your online visibility.

Analyzing the Competition
Take a peek at your competitors! What keywords are they ranking for? This can give you insight into what works in your niche. Analyze their content, backlinks, and site structure. This doesn"t mean copying them; it"s about learning from their success.
Creating a Keyword Strategy
Once you"ve gathered your keywords, it"s time to create a plan. Prioritize your keywords based on search volume and competition. Develop content that naturally incorporates these keywords while providing value to your audience. Remember, keyword stuffing is a big no-no. Aim for a seamless integration that reads naturally!

Link Building: The Power of Connections
Building backlinks is crucial for SEO. Think of backlinks as votes of confidence from other websites. The more high-quality backlinks you have, the more authoritative your site becomes in the eyes of Google. Collaborate with influencers, guest post on relevant blogs, and share your content on social media to build those essential links.

Using Google Analytics
This free tool helps you track user behavior, traffic sources, and conversion rates. You can see which pages are performing well and which ones need a little TLC. Utilize this data to refine your content and SEO strategies.
